    A facebook friend from school, PM'ed me that he liked my "Carved With Love" page. And that he wanted one of the two piece face crosses. After we agreed on a price... he threw down the gauntlet. He informed me that his King James version of the bible says, "And my King James Bible tells me to have no grave image of Jesus, so I would need one with his eyes open and alive." !! I tried to explain that the pattern was old and had been around so long, no one knows who created it. But only the owner could edit the pattern. He said he was patient and had faith I would figure it out. So I did!! I didn't edit the pattern! I just clicked all of the merge, clip and group options until something worked! Any ways... Here is the MPC if any one wants to use it. I know these are always hot sellers around Christmas and Easter!
